A Nasdaq-listed Solana (SOL) treasury company is turning to the public equity markets to raise fresh capital for its ongoing digital asset accumulation strategy, proposing a $20 million preferred stock offering aimed at growing its SOL holdings.
DeFi Development Corp, which trades on Nasdaq under the ticker DFDV, announced the proposed offering on Aug. 31. The company plans to issue Variable Rate Series C perpetual preferred stock at a stated value of $10 per share, with dividends accruing at a variable rate beginning at 13% annually. The first dividend payment is scheduled for Oct. 1, 2026.
Dividend Reserve To Be Established at Closing
Upon closing, DeFi Development said it will fund a dividend reserve covering the first 12 months of payments at the 13% rate. The reserve can be funded through cash, financial instruments, or digital assets. R.F. Lafferty & Co has been named book-running manager for the offering.
Proceeds would go toward general corporate purposes, with SOL purchases and other crypto-related investments named as the primary uses. The announcement came days after the company said on Aug. 27 that it had resumed buying Solana, acquiring roughly 19,000 SOL at an average price of $98.14. That purchase brought its total holdings to approximately 2.33 million SOL and equivalents.

CEO Points to Leveraged SOL Exposure as Core to the DFDV Model
CEO Joseph Onorati said last week that the company is structured to give investors amplified exposure to Solana and that recent trading showed the market was beginning to recognize that proposition. He described the combination of SOL exposure, trading liquidity, and treasury yield as the defining features of how DFDV operates.
DFDV shares rose 8.03% on Aug. 31 to close at $5.38. The stock has climbed 110% over the past month but is flat year-to-date. SOL gained 1.9% in the same 24-hour window to trade at $103.30. The cryptocurrency is up 41% over the past month but remains down 17% since the start of 2026.
